package edu.buaa.satla.analysis.util;

import java.util.HashSet;
import java.util.Set;

import com.google.common.collect.ImmutableMap;

public class ImmutableMapMerger {
    public interface MergeFunc<K, V> {
        V apply(K key, V a, V b);
    }

    /**
     * Join two maps taking the key into account, use {@code func} on duplicate values.
     * @param a input map
     * @param b input map
     * @param func function to merge two values from different maps.
     * @return map containing the union of keys in {@code a} and {@code b}, which
     * contains the value from {@code a} if it contains only in {@code a}, value
     * from {@code b} if it is contained only in {@code b} and {@code func}
     * applied on value from {@code a} and a value from {@code b} otherwise.
     */
    public static <K, V> ImmutableMap<K, V> merge(ImmutableMap<K, V> a, ImmutableMap<K, V> b,
            MergeFunc<K, V> func) {
        Set<K> allKeys = new HashSet<>();

        allKeys.addAll(a.keySet());
        allKeys.addAll(b.keySet());

        ImmutableMap.Builder<K, V> builder = ImmutableMap.builder();

        for (K key : allKeys) {
            if (a.containsKey(key) && !b.containsKey(key)) {
                builder.put(key, a.get(key));
            } else if (!a.containsKey(key) && b.containsKey(key)) {
                builder.put(key, b.get(key));
            } else {
                builder.put(key, func.apply(key, a.get(key), b.get(key)));
            }
        }
        return builder.build();
    }
}
